Defaults changed for the rollout framework. Since you're new to the Penhallow team: Flagwright previously evaluated flags with sticky bucketing off and a 30-second cache TTL. Both defaults have changed — bucketing is now sticky by user key, and the cache TTL dropped to 10 seconds to reduce stale reads during staged rollouts. Existing environments keep their pinned values; only newly created projects pick up the new defaults. Before touching anything, confirm your environment against the current defaults, which are as follows.

deployment values, yadug-bawif:
[framir]
team = pelox
access_code = ac_a38ab2
owner = tamion.julael
host = framir.tolvaqlabs.test
port = 11211
peer = tammir.zemvargrid.local
salt = 2215ef03
pin = 1541

TURN-208: Gatevale turnstile counters at the Merrow Field pilot double-count when a rotation reverses mid-cycle. Attendance totals drift roughly 2% high per event. The debounce window fix is implemented, reviewed by Ilsa, and soak-tested across two simulated match days without drift. Ready for your cut; the candidate build is identified below.

trace token, tagag-tafog: htk6_5ed18c

Subject: Lumenrate cut-over complete

Team, the Lumenrate FX converter cut-over finished at 03:10. We traced the half-cent drift to banker's rounding being applied twice, once in the quoting layer and once at settlement. The fix pins rounding to the settlement step only. If alerts fire tonight, verify the service is running with the following configuration values.

config for kafof-bawef:
holath:
  log_level: debug
  metrics_host: metrics.holath.qorvelsys.internal
  pin: 2191
  pool_size: 32